Eat the right foods for healthy hair

Your hair is made up of two structures: the visible hair shaft and the hidden hair follicle. To promote hair growth, you need to feed your hair from within. Hair follicles are sensitive to nutrition deficiencies, toxins, and malnutrition, which can lead to poor hair growth and hair loss. High protein foods like fish, beans, nuts and whole grains are fantastic fuel for hair growth. Taking supplements that include biotin and vitamins B and C also supports hair growth.

Schedule regular hair appointments

One of the most common misconceptions is that avoiding haircuts will lead to faster hair growth. However, this couldn't be further from the truth. Regular trimming is essential to keep your hair healthy and free from split ends. Untreated split ends travel up the hair shaft, causing breakage and thinning. It’s important to schedule frequent visits to your hairdresser to ensure the ends remain fresh and to promote healthier growth from the roots. Stroke of genius: tangle less, shine more Aside from detangling knots, using the right brush for your hair type and regularly brushing your hair is so important for hair health – the benefits far exceeding those of expensive hair products and treatments. Regular brushing is essential for maintaining healthy, shiny hair. It distributes natural oils, reducing frizz and breakage while keeping hair hydrated. Brushing also removes dead skin and product buildup, champion for promoting a healthier scalp. By stimulating circulation, it encourages hair growth and scalp nourishment. Wash with care, don’t despair Over washing your hair strips it of its precious natural oils, leaving it dry and prone to breakage. It’s important to find the balance between hair hygiene and over washing. Your hair will give you signs it is being washed too much: Hair colour fades – every time you shampoo the colour fades and becomes less vibrant. Changes in texture – curls may lose definition or become frizzy , your once soft hair feels coarser and drier. More split ends – hair is vulnerable when it’s wet, so the more time it spends in a weakened state, the greater the risk of breakage and split ends. Loss of shine – natural hair oils are responsible for that gorgeous sheen of healthy hair, over washing causes hair to look lacklustre. How often you should wash your hair is open to debate, it depends on your skin and hair type, hairstyle and lifestyle. Shampoo wisely, condition kindly Not all shampoos and conditioners are created equal, and choosing the right ones for your hair type makes a big difference. The best shampoo will cleanse gently while addressing specific concerns like dryness, oiliness, or colour maintenance. Using the wrong formula, such as an ultra-moisturising shampoo on fine hair or a clarifying shampoo too often, can throw your hair off balance. A good conditioner is essential for keeping hair smooth and manageable – it is the guardian of your hair and helps prevent dryness and split ends. The best hair conditioner for you depends on what you are trying to achieve – do you want smoother slicker hair, more volume or curl definition? Selecting the right shampoo and conditioner ensures your hair stays clean, nourished, and healthy while helping maintain the shape and integrity of your style between salon visits.
